Hi dude! I haven't picked up the 4070 Ti yet. I'm doing tests at 1440p with my old warrior 1070 Ti. I'm even surprised. Most of the time it has maintained 60 fps (I locked it at 60 with vsync). The worst fps I got were with the AH-64 in dense regions (40 fps). With the F-16 I also got close to 40 fps with the TGP on and dense vegetation. With the F-18 I also had around 40 fps while in the supercarrier and in the rain. I have done all the tests in multiplauer (GS, 4YA and DDCS). But in general it has maintained 80, 90% of the time with a solid 60 fps.- 29 replies

Hey guys. Another topic about "building a new PC". My question is whether the VGA I'm choosing will work for what I want. My intention is to play at 2K and the setup I'm building is this: - i7 12700K - Gigabyte B660M Aorus PRO - 64GB (2x32GB) Kingston Fury Beast, 3200MHz, DDR4, CL16 - SSD 2 TB Kingston Fury Renegade, M.2 2280 PCIe, NVMe, 7300 / 7000 - Screen Asus TUF 31.5 LED 2K QHD, Curved, 144Hz, 1ms, VG32VQ with TIR 5 Most of the time I play multiplayer. Now the question: will an RTX 4070 Asus OC Edition NVIDIA GeForce, 12 GB GDDR6X, be able to run at 2K on a 31.5" screen with more than 60fps in multiplayer? Thank you for the patience. Seeya!
